Original members Richard and Tim Butler and John Ashton, along with Richard Butler's writing partner Richard Fortus on guitar and Earl Harvin on drums, will again showcase the Psychedelic Furs' old material like "Love My Way," "The Ghost in You," and "Pretty in Pink." But this time around the Furs also plan to preview some new tunes that they plan to record immediately following the tour, which runs from March 23rd to May 10th.
